prepare to be shocked then

You’re right he is similar to Seymour, except he is much more athletic. And Rich can play DT or DE. Suh is suitable for many different schemes in the NFL. He is tremendous @ the point of attack which will demand double teams and that’s exactly what you need a 34 DE or a 43 DT to do.

 Now if you were saying he isn’t a good fit for a true NT, like in a 3-4 I tend to agree, because you would be neglecting his greatest assets by placing him in a zero technique and making him eat up blockers.

If Suh is available when we pick we would be ignorant to pass over him. He is truly a rare breed.
